Rhubarb Custard Cake
Ingredients
Instructions
-
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9-inch round cake pan.
-
In a mixing bowl, combine the flour, baking powder, and salt.
-
In another bowl, cream together the butter and granulated sugar.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.
-
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the butter mixture, alternating with the milk. Mix until just combined.
-
Spread the batter evenly into the prepared cake pan. Arrange the rhubarb pieces on top.
-
Bake for 40-45 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
-
Remove from the oven and let cool in the pan for 10 minutes. Then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
-
Dust with powdered sugar before serving.
